Latest Patents
One of his latest patents is titled "Systems and methods for graphite electrode identification and monitoring." This innovative system includes a graphite electrode with a graphite body featuring first and second opposed ends. The electrode is equipped with a threaded connector at one of the ends, along with a tag that transmits a signal containing information related to the electrode. Another significant patent under his name is also focused on monitoring graphite electrodes for use in electric arc furnaces. This system involves receiving electrode identifiers from a radio frequency identification (RFID) tag reader, which interrogates RFID tags attached to electrodes in the vicinity of an electric arc furnace. The data collected is crucial for generating current and past operating parameters of the electric arc furnace for specific electrodes.
